Barend Abeln began his career at Unilever (Rotterdam, Netherlands) in the economics department, where he reported on macroeconomic developments in European countries. Subsequently, he became a product manager at Unilever Frozen Foods (Utrecht). In 1972, he entered the real estate market as a founder and CEO of Vlakland Planontwikkeling BV, realizing five second-home projects and a hotel on the French Côte d'Azur. In 1982, he became a private investment consultant in Amsterdam and developed a state-of-the-art seasonal adjustment process.

Jan P.A.M. Jacobs studied econometrics at the University of Groningen (Netherlands) and played volleyball at international level (46 international matches). After a brief position at Philips Medical Systems, he returned to his alma mater and received his Ph.D. on "Econometric Business Cycle Research" in 1998. He is an associate professor at the Faculty of Economics of the University of Groningen, where he taught applied macroecometrics to research master students and supervises bachelor, master graduate theses.


He published more than forty articles in peer-reviewed journals in economics (Journal of Econometrics, Journal of Applied EconometricsJournal of Business & Economic StatisticsMacroeconomics DynamicsScandinavian Journal of EconomicsJournal of Macroeconomics), law (International Journal of Law in the Built Environment), and medicine (BMC Family PracticeEconomics and Human Biology).



Chapter 1. Introduction.- Chapter 2. CAMPLET: Seasonal adjustment without revisions.- Chapter 3. Seasonal adjustment of economic tendency survey data.- Chapter 4. Residual Seasonality: A Comparison of X13 and CAMPLET.- Chapter 5. COVID-19 and Seasonal Adjustment.- Chapter 6. Seasonal adjustment of daily data with CAMPLET.- Chapter 7. Conclusion
